At Babcock we’re working to create a safe and secure world, together, and if you join us, you can play your part as a Driver and Ground Handler at our RAF Benson site.
The role
As a Driver and Ground Handler, you’ll have a role that’s out of the ordinary. You’ll be part of a small, friendly Transport Services team where people work well together and take pride in doing the job properly. You’ll be driving a mix of vehicles, from cars and minibuses to rigid and articulated LGVs, depending on the task. The job is about getting RAF personnel, vehicles and equipment where they need to be, safely and on time. It’s a well-structured driving role on a unique RAF site, offering variety in the work and the chance to be part of a dependable and supportive team.
Day-to-day you’ll be responsible for:
- Transporting recruits and station personnel between units and the local area using a range of vehicles
- Carrying out detailed monthly checks of the vehicle fleet and reporting any defects to the Transport Control Office
- Preparing vehicles for events such as graduation days
Uniform will be provided and must be worn as a matter of company policy.
This role is full time and based onsite at RAF Benson, near Oxfordshire. You’ll work an average of 39 hours a week on a shift basis. There are early, day, and evening shifts available, with preferences taken into account where possible. Shifts are planned in advance, although some flexibility may occasionally be required to meet operational needs.
Essential experience of the Driver and Ground Handler:
- Experience of driving a range of vehicles
- A good working knowledge of Driver's Hours Regulations in line with EU Directive 561/2006
- CAT B Licence
- Large Goods Vehicles (LGV) DVLA Licence Category C
- Digital Tachograph Card
- Security Clearance
The successful candidate must be able to achieve and maintain BPSS security clearance EDBS for this role.
